Douglas County Museum
The Douglas County Museum is based on the cultural and natural history of Roseburg and its surroundings. This museum holds the second largest historic photograph collection in the state of Oregon. With more than 24,000 photos, dating all the way back to the 19th century. Roseburg staff member, Ken Frazierand shared what he likes about the museum, saying, “It’s good for the kids and there’s lots of activities to do.” The museum is located next to the Douglas County Fairgrounds, 123 Museum Drive, Roseburg, OR 97471.
